Vue
Vue.js是一款流行的JavaScript框架,用于构建交互式的Web界面,它具有简洁的语法和快速的性能,使得开发者可以更轻松地构建复杂的单页面应用程序,Vue提供了许多有用的功能,如数据绑定、组件化和虚拟DOM,使得开发过程更加高效和简单。
Node
Node.js是一个基于Chrome V8引擎的JavaScript运行时环境,可以用来构建快速的网络应用程序,Node.js具有非阻塞I/O和事件驱动的特性,使得它非常适合构建高性能的服务器端应用程序,开发者可以使用Node.js来处理HTTP请求、数据库操作和文件系统操作等任务。
搭建网站教程
要使用Vue和Node.js搭建一个网站,首先需要安装Node.js和Vue CLI,Vue CLI是一个官方提供的脚手架工具,可以帮助我们快速搭建Vue项目,安装完成后,我们可以使用Vue CLI创建一个新的Vue项目,并在项目中安装Vue Router和Axios等插件。
接下来,我们需要创建一个Node.js服务器来处理HTTP请求,可以使用Express框架来构建Node.js服务器,它提供了一系列方便的API来处理HTTP请求和路由,我们可以创建一个简单的Express服务器,并在其中编写路由来处理前端发送的请求。
在Vue项目中,我们可以使用Axios来发送HTTP请求到后端服务器,通过Axios发送请求后,后端服务器会接收到请求并返回相应的数据,我们可以在Vue组件中使用Axios来获取数据,并将数据展示在页面上。
我们可以将前端Vue项目和后端Node.js服务器部署到云服务器上,可以使用服务提供商如AWS、Google Cloud或Heroku来部署我们的应用程序,通过部署到云服务器上,我们的网站就可以在全球范围内访问。
总结一下,使用Vue和Node.js搭建网站需要安装Vue CLI和Node.js,创建Vue项目和Node.js服务器,使用Axios发送HTTP请求,最后部署到云服务器上,这样我们就可以构建一个完整的网站应用程序。